Our Working Documents |
We are not bound to any particular hardware platform. The GNU
system and the Linux kernel run on most platforms, and our working
documents help porting to specific hardware or application
environments, according to different needs.
These documents are our collection of notes for bringing the power
and the freedom of the GNU system on different hardware.
